Welder | Weekly Pay Job Description We are seeking skilled welders to join our team in producing exhaust systems for various markets, including power generation, oil & gas, marine, locomotive, construction, and off-road. This role primarily involves MIG welding on mild and stainless steel. Tack welding and assembling exhaust systems will also be part of the duties, although the focus will be on custom and production-style MIG welding. The role requires reading blueprints and weld symbols and the ability to perform a variety of tasks in the shop. Responsibilities Perform MIG welding on mild and stainless steel to produce exhaust systems. Tack weld and assemble exhaust systems as required. Read and interpret blueprints and weld symbols to build products. Assist with fabrication tasks such as operating a brake press, shear, and roller. Participate in a weld test by building a product from a blueprint. Essential Skills Proficiency in MIG welding. Ability to read and interpret blueprints and weld symbols. Experience with metal fabrication and the ability to perform various tasks in a fabrication shop. Additional Skills & Qualifications Experience with plasma cutting and using tape measures.
